5.9.10. RADIUS Parameters
In the Text Interface, the RADIUS Parameters menu is accessed via the Network
Configuration menu (/N for IPv4 parameters or /N6 for IPv6 parameters.) In the Web
Browser Interface, both IPv4 and IPv6 parameters are defined via a single RADIUS
Parameters menu, which is accessed via the flyout menus under the Network
Configuration link. The RADIUS Configuration Menus offer the following options:
• Enable: Enables/Disables the RADIUS feature at the Network Port. (Default = Off)
• PrimaryAddressIPv4: Defines the IP address or domain name for your primary
RADIUS server when IPv4 protocol is used. (Default = undefined)
• PrimaryAddressIPv6: Defines the IP address or domain name for your primary
RADIUS server when IPv6 protocol is used. (Default = undefined)
• PrimarySecretWord: Defines the RADIUS Secret Word for the primary RADIUS
server. (Default = undefined)
• SecondaryAddressIPv4: Defines the IP address or domain name for your
secondary, fallback RADIUS server when IPv4 protocol is used.
(Default = undefined)
• SecondaryAddressIPv6: Defines the IP address or domain name for your
secondary, fallback RADIUS server when IPv6 protocol is used.
(Default = undefined)
• SecondarySecretWord: Defines the RADIUS Secret Word for the secondary
RADIUS server. (Default = undefined)
• FallbackTimer: Determines how long the RPC will continue to attempt to contact
the primary RADIUS Server before falling back to the secondary RADIUS Server.
(Default = 3 Seconds)
• FallbackLocal: Determines whether or not the RPC will fallback to its own
password/username directory when an authentication attempt fails. When enabled,
the RPC will first attempt to authenticate the password by checking the RADIUS
Server; if this fails, the RPC will then attempt to authenticate the password by
checking its own internal username directory. This parameter offers three options:
Off: Fallback Local is disabled (Default.)
On(AllFailures): Fallback Local is enabled, and the unit will fallback to it's
own internal user directory when it cannot contact the Radius Server, or when a
password or username does not match the Radius Server.
On(TransportFailure): Fallback Local is enabled, but the unit will only fallback
to it's own internal user directory when it cannot contact the Radius Server.
• Retries: Determines how many times the RPC will attempt to contact the RADIUS
server. Note that the retries parameter applies to both the Primary RADIUS Server
and the Secondary RADIUS Server. (Default = 3)
• AuthenticationPort: The Authentication Port number for the RADIUS function.
(Default = 1812)
